轴承箱大小半定性分析及对汽轮机安装影响

摘    要:轴承箱一般被设计成上下半结构,但现有加工技术和方法不能保证产品的水平中分切面正好在设计理论面上,于是就出现大小半问题。大小半问题会对汽轮机组安装产生很大影响,对此目前国内还没有研究资料可供借鉴。文章通过总结和理论分析,详细介绍了轴承箱大小半的测量、计算、定义、分类及对汽轮机组安装的影响。

关 键 词:轴承箱大小半  定义  分类  影响

Qualitative Analysis of Bearing Box Half Size and Impact for Steam Turbine Installation

Abstract:Bearing box structure is designed with two halves,but existing processing and methods can not guarantee the product's level section just in design,so it is the box problem of half size.The boxing half size problem has a great influence on turbine installation,there is no research data for reference currently.Through the summary and theoretical analysis,the paper has introduced the measurement,calculation,definition and classification of boxing half size and the effect on turbine unit installation in detail.
Keywords:bearing box half size  definition  classification  influence
